Output 14e586341f07a329421a94f92c7233fe65db5158a1fd5b1650e65504ba8c82ba:3

value
183098
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c192907b029740883af25836c71d02c0147e8d9e OP_EQUAL
address
3KLXv3BeqPtaQad9dj441pur7mZfCYczFS
transaction
14e586341f07a329421a94f92c7233fe65db5158a1fd5b1650e65504ba8c82ba
spent
true